Design Goal:
Remove power from 4 washing machines and 4 dryers using relays and a digital logic timer.
(9 Hour cycle of no-power from 22:00 to 07:00 the next day)
Design Problem:
What relays can I use that can be actuated by logic voltages?
Should I use 2 relays, a logic relay that actuates a power relay?
What relay can I use that can handle continuous amp draw of 8 machines and 8 start up amp draws?
Theory:
Digital Logic timer to send a shut down sequence to each of the 4 relays (2 plugs x 4 receptacles)
Relays (SPST-NC latching) or (SPST-NO)
Also, a feasibility study of anyone who has either done this before or done something similar or has any insight to anything I should be aware of.
